Ok, Iam going to set up a new system and I noticed that their motherboards need extra power imputs besides the ATX 20pin connector? What other power imput do I need to use?
 
It's a 4 pin 12v connector. I think most power supplies come with one, I know my Enermax did. Even some non-Athlon 64 mobos are using the extra connector though, Barton and P4 boards use it.
 
My manual for my Chaintech nForce3 mobo I got for my A64 says that an ATX PSU should come with the required connector. It stated it like it is common run-of-the-mill.
 
if u dont have one can get an adapter from compusa,microcenter or computer shop.that way u dont have to get a new ps.should cost about 5 dollars.
